Paint Your Skeeter Trailer
Bob Kau visits the Past Champions Skeeter Shop.
What do you do when your runners are sharpened, your Skeeters are ready for ice, and the temperature is a balmy 70F in the middle of December? The guys next door to iceboat.org HQ, Ken Whitehorse and Paul Krueger of the Past Champions Iceboat Shop, made good use of the day and painted their trailer. However, today’s falling temperatures moved the project back inside for wheel-bearing packing, almost as important as sharp runners.

“Madison or Minnesota?”
Madison or Minnesota? Minnesota C Skeeter sailor Pat Heppert posted the photo and question on Facebook over the weekend. Unfortunately, the Madison area must live vicariously through our Minnesota friends for some time. This Wednesday’s forecast of 64F will not help with ice making in southern Wisconsin, but it’s all downhill temperature-wise from then.
The former Jerry Simon boat SIMONIZED IV belongs to Mike Maloney. Pat and Mike sailed on some beautiful ice north of Brainerd, MN, on Round Lake while the MN DN crowd crossed the highway to sail on 4″ of black ice at Gull Lake.
MARY B Film News
Via Don Sanford:
The Ice Boat Foundation is thrilled to announce that our documentary film, Mary B: Madison’s Legendary Iceboat has been accepted into the Green Bay International Film Festival. Plan a trip to Title Town (Green Bay) on Thursday, February 10, 2022. We’re screening the film at the Green Bay Distillery. There’ll be good food, good drinks and plenty of talk about iceboats—what a combination. The filmmakers will be there and look forward to seeing you. More info here.

Western Challenge Tune-Up Day

Skip Dieball and Chad Atkins get ready to push off.
Bright sunshine, moderately light winds, and reasonably hard ice made for a perfect first day on the ice at Lake Christina. Marks were set, and laps were run. We had just a dusting of snow in Battle Lake overnight, and we expect moderate wind and temperatures. “Father Nature shows up around noon and we’ll go from there.” Photos from Thursday, 2 December, 2021 on Lake Christina near Ashby, MN.
